During which high frequency application treatment does the client hold the electrode?

Explanation:
High-frequency treatments can be delivered in different configurations depending on who holds the electrode. The scenario where the client holds the electrode is Indirect High Frequency. In this setup, the current is carried through the client’s body by holding the electrode (often with a damp cloth or barrier to minimize irritation), while the esthetician may keep the other components in place and guide the treatment. The client becoming the conductor allows a gentler, more comfortable experience and still delivers the warm, stimulating benefits of the treatment without the esthetician directly applying the wand to the client’s skin. Direct high frequency would involve the clinician applying the electrode directly to the client’s skin, which is more intense. Static and neutral high frequency refer to different modes or configurations of the current and grounding that aren’t defined by the client holding the electrode.
